Fujitsu UK is seeking a Head of Cyber Security to define and drive the organisation’s security strategy, governance and operational resilience.

You will lead a high‑impact function, translating security risk into business decisions while supporting growth, client confidence and regulatory obligations.

You will shape security capabilities, manage key stakeholder relationships, and champion secure by design across platforms, products and services.

How to prepare for a job interview at Fujitsu Careers

Sharpen Your Technical Skills

For a role in cybersecurity, it’s essential to be up-to-date with the latest tools and techniques. Brush up on your knowledge of fir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and vulnerability assessment tools. Be ready to discuss specific scenarios where you’ve applied these skills, as hands-on experience can really set us apart in interviews.

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ions

Expect the interviewers at Fujitsu Careers to throw in some hypothetical situations to see how you’d handle them. Think about common security breaches or incidents and be prepared to explain how you would respond. This not only shows your problem-solving skills but also your understanding of real-world cybersecurity challenges.

Highlight Your Certifications

Certifications like CompTIA Security+, CISSP, or CEH can give you a significant edge in a full-time role in cybersecurity. Make sure to mention these during your interview and be prepared to discuss what you learned through those certifications and how they relate to the position at Fujitsu Careers.
